The Lawyers' Movement, also known as the Movement for the Restoration of Judiciary or the Black Coat Protests,
The Lawyers' Movement was the popular mass protest movement initiated by the lawyers of Pakistan in response to the former president and army chief Pervez Musharraf's actions of 9 March 2007
Date: 9 March 2007 — 17 March 2009
Location: Nationwide, throughout Pakistan
Caused by: Suspension of chief justice Iftikhar Muhammad Chaudhry
